Overview

Odis Oliver Flores (born June 18, 1987), most famously known as O.T. Genasis, is an American rapper, singer, and songwriter. Born in Atlanta, Georgia, he spent his formative years in Long Beach, California, where he developed his unique musical style influenced by both Southern and West Coast hip-hop. O.T. Genasis’s career began to gain momentum after signing with G-Unit Records in 2011 and later with Conglomerate Records under Busta Rhymes. He released his debut mixtape, Black Belt, in 2012. He rose to widespread recognition with the hit single “CoCo” in 2014, which peaked at number 20 on the Billboard Hot 100 chart. His success continued with “Cut It” featuring Young Dolph. Beyond music, O.T. Genasis is known for his energetic performances and collaborations with other prominent artists. He is also stepping into reality TV, starring in The Surreal Life: Villa of Secrets Season 8. O.T. Genasis has two sons: Genasis Flores and Ace Flores.

O.T. Genasis’ Career Highlights and Earnings

O.T. Genasis, born Odis Oliver Flores, embarked on his professional music journey with significant milestones that have contributed to his $4 million net worth. In 2011, he secured a recording contract with G-Unit Records, which marked his formal entry into the music industry. Subsequently, he aligned with Conglomerate Records, further solidifying his industry presence. His debut mixtape, “Black Belt,” released in 2012, served as his initial offering to the music world, setting the stage for future projects. A pivotal moment in O.T. Genasis’ career occurred with the release of his single “CoCo.” This track achieved significant chart success, reaching #4 on the US Rap chart, #5 on the US R&B chart, and #20 on the Billboard Hot 100 chart. Following the success of “CoCo,” O.T. Genasis released another hit single, “Cut It,” featuring Young Dolph. This track further solidified his presence in the music scene, reaching #6 on the US Rap chart, #11 on the US R&B chart, and #35 on the Billboard Hot 100 chart. In addition to his commercially successful singles, O.T. Genasis has released mixtapes such as “Catastrophic 2” (in collaboration with Busta Rhymes and J-Doe) in 2014 and “Rhythm & Bricks” in 2015. These mixtapes, while often distributed for free or at a low cost, serve as promotional tools to build his fanbase and generate opportunities for paid performances and collaborations.
